Galvanized Grating: Strength and Durability in Every Step

Galvanized grating offers unmatched strength and durability, making it the ideal solution for a wide range of applications. Constructed from high-quality steel coated with a protective layer of zinc, this durable grating resists corrosion, rust, and wear. Whether used in industrial settings, construction projects, or commercial spaces, galvanized grating stands up to the most demanding conditions. Its robust design ensures safe passage for pedestrians and equipment, while its open construction allows for efficient drainage and ventilation. , In addition , galvanized grating is lightweight and easy to install, reducing labor costs and installation time.
